§ 22a-27t — Face of Connecticut account.

Connecticut·Title 22a Environmental Protection·Ch. 439 Department of Energy and Environmental Protection. State Policy

There is established an account to be known as the “Face of Connecticut account” which shall be a separate, nonlapsing account within the General Fund. The account shall contain any moneys required by law to be deposited in the account and contributions from any source, public or private. Any moneys in the account shall be expended by the Commissioner of Energy and Environmental Protection, as directed by the Face of Connecticut Steering Committee established pursuant to section 22a-27s for the acquisition, restoration or stewardship of properties, each of which such properties, when acquired or restored, will serve not less than two of the following objectives:

(1)The conservation of open space land, as defined in section 12-107b;
(2)the renovation and enhancement of urban parks;

Legislative History

(P.A. 08-174, S. 1; P.A. 11-80, S. 1.) History: P.A. 08-174 effective June 13, 2008; pursuant to P.A. 11-80, “Commissioner of Environmental Protection” was changed editorially by the Revisors to “Commissioner of Energy and Environmental Protection”, effective July 1, 2011.
